Recognized for two consecutive years by US News and World Report as a high performing unit, the BirthPlace at Sinai Hospital is an integral part of the Baltimore community performing 1,800 births annually.
We are recipients of the 2022 Minogue Award Circle of Honor given by the Maryland Patient Safety Center in recognition of our innovations in patient safety.
Since 2018, Sinai Hospital is a Regional Medical Campus of the George Washington University School of Medicine and Health Sciences.
Sinai serves the people of greater Baltimore as well as national and international patients.
Sinai Hospital is a nonprofit teaching hospital with an ACGME accredited residency program providing training for more than 140 residents. With 399 acute beds, Sinai is the largest community hospital in Maryland.
